The Center for Management and International Cooperation for Development (CGCID) is a private research center, it is constituted as an interdisciplinary work space, integrating ideas and in permanent innovation. It is characterized by the use of avant - garde methodologies and creative solutions according to the needs and / or specificities of each territory and is based on the integration of experience, knowledge and collaboration of a network of professionals and academics.
MISSION
Generate and facilitate solutions to development problems at the local, regional, national and global levels through applied research; the generation of studies and strategic information; technical assistance; project management and coordination; training, and the creation of intervention models.
VIEW
To be a reference organization at the regional level in the research and application of models of international cooperation and management for development, in order to strengthen the capacities and contribute to the improvement of the decision making of the governments and of the diverse public actors , private and social to respond proactively and strategically to current and future development challenges.
